MySQL:为何查询速度突然下降?
MySQL查询速度突然下降可能有多种原因,下面列举一些常见的:
数据量增加:如果数据库中的记录数量激增,查询效率会显著降低。这时可以通过优化查询语句、分批插入数据等方式提高性能。
索引失效或不恰当使用:索引是加速查询的关键。如果索引被删除或者创建不当(如主键、唯一性字段的索引),查询速度将大大下降。
查询优化问题:编写查询时,如果没有遵循最佳实践,比如避免全表扫描、尽量减少联接操作等,可能会导致查询性能低下。
系统资源限制:如果服务器的内存不足、CPU核心数量不够或者磁盘空间紧张,都可能导致MySQL查询速度下降。
还没有评论,来说两句吧...